Tips for Defensive Driving in Driving Lessons Prestons

Introduction: Driving in Prestons, or any urban area, demands more than just knowing how to operate a vehicle. It requires mastering defensive driving techniques to navigate safely through busy streets, unexpected situations, and potential hazards. Whether you’re a novice or experienced driver, adopting defensive driving habits can significantly reduce the risk of accidents and ensure a smoother journey. In this article, we’ll explore essential tips tailored for driving lessons in Prestons, focusing on proactive strategies to stay safe on the road.

1.Stay Alert and Focused: One of the fundamental principles of defensive driving is to stay vigilant at all times. Pay close attention to your surroundings, including other vehicles, pedestrians, cyclists, and road signs. Avoid distractions such as using your phone, eating, or adjusting the radio while driving. Keep your hands on the wheel and your eyes on the road to anticipate potential threats and react promptly.

2.Maintain a Safe Following Distance: Maintaining a safe following distance is crucial, especially in congested areas like Prestons. Keep a distance of at least three seconds between your vehicle and the one in front of you. This buffer allows you ample time to react if the vehicle ahead suddenly brakes or encounters an obstacle. Adjust your following distance based on weather conditions, traffic density, and your speed.

3.Anticipate Potential Hazards: Predicting potential hazards is a key aspect of defensive driving. Scan the road ahead for any signs of danger, such as erratic driving behavior, pedestrians crossing, or upcoming intersections. Be prepared to react swiftly by slowing down, changing lanes, or stopping if necessary. Anticipating hazards gives you the advantage of proactive decision-making, reducing the likelihood of accidents.

4.Use Defensive Lane Positioning: Your positioning within your lane can significantly impact your safety on the road. Stay centered within your lane to maintain visibility and minimize the risk of collisions with adjacent vehicles or roadside obstacles. When driving alongside parked cars, leave enough space to avoid potential door openings or sudden maneuvers. Positioning yourself defensively enhances your visibility and maneuverability, enhancing overall safety.

5.Practice Patience and Courtesy: Patience and courtesy are essential virtues for defensive drivers, particularly in busy urban environments like Prestons. Avoid aggressive driving behaviors such as tailgating, weaving through traffic, or engaging in road rage. Instead, practice patience by yielding to other motorists, allowing merging vehicles to enter your lane, and respecting traffic signals. Cultivating a mindset of mutual respect fosters a safer driving environment for everyone.

6.Prepare for Adverse Conditions: Prestons, like any other location, is susceptible to adverse weather conditions and unexpected events. Be prepared to adjust your driving technique accordingly, whether it’s rain, fog, snow, or glare from the sun. Slow down, increase your following distance, and use headlights or fog lights as necessary to enhance visibility. Additionally, familiarize yourself with alternative routes in case of road closures or traffic diversions.
